About this home

This beautifully updated two-story home offers 3 bedrooms, 2.5 bathrooms, and approximately 1,699 sq. ft. of living space on a spacious 7,405 sq. ft. lot. The remodeled kitchen boasts stunning quartz countertops, new cabinets, a stylish tile backsplash, a beverage refrigerator, and an upgraded stainless-steel sink with a pull-down spray faucet. Luxury vinyl plank flooring enhances the home's modern appeal, while upgraded bathrooms and fresh interior paint add to its move-in-ready charm. Plantation shutters throughout provide elegance and privacy. The inviting living room features a cozy fireplace, perfect for relaxing evenings. Step outside to a large backyard, complete with a sparkling pool, a versatile shed, and a grassy side yard perfect for play or relaxation. The attached garage features epoxy flooring, updated insulation, and enhanced electrical, including a Tesla charger. Situated on a desirable cul-de-sac, this home boasts amazing curb appeal and thoughtful upgrades throughout. A must-see!
